Well, that’s essentially what happened to Verda Byrd. Verda was adopted by an African-American couple, and raised as their only child. After 70 long years she learned that she was not in fact black at all. (That’s a bummer!)

Verda Byrd has told people she is black her whole life - but she is no Rachel Dolezal. Verda actually lived the life of a black person, she didn’t spray tan her body or go out and buy weaves to appear black. She was raised black!

According to local news station Ken 5, Verda stated:

“I didn’t know what I was…It was never told to me that I was white.”
